Орбитальный шаровой клапан GQ47H
The GQ47H orbital ball valve is suitable for industries such as petrochemicals, liquefied petroleum gas storage, oil refineries, природный газ, compressor systems, oil and gas pipelines, light industry, and textiles. (GQ47H, GQ347H, GQ647H, GQ947H)
Название продукта: Orbital Ball Valve
Модель продукта: GQ47H, GQ347H, GQ647H, GQ947H
Номинальный диаметр: DN25~DN500
Тип структуры: сферический
Номинальное давление: 1.6МПа~32,0 МПа
Способ подключения: Фланец
Применимая температура: ≤550°С
Метод срабатывания: Руководство, Electric, Pneumatic
Материал корпуса клапана: Литая сталь, Углеродистая сталь, Кованая сталь, Нержавеющая сталь
Производственный стандарт: ГБ (Китайский национальный стандарт), ОТ (Немецкий стандарт), API (Американский стандарт), АНСИ (Американский стандарт)
Применимые носители: Вода, Масло, Пар, Natural Gas, Liquids, Gases, и т. д..
Производитель: Чжэцзянская компания Kozo Valve Co., ООО.

GQ47H Orbit Ball Valve Product Features
1. Беспрепятственное открытие и закрытие. This function completely solves the problem of sealing issues caused by friction between sealing surfaces in traditional valves.
2. Top-entry structure. Valves installed on pipelines can be directly inspected and maintained online. This effectively reduces plant shutdowns and lowers production costs.
3. Single seat design. Eliminates the problem of safety issues caused by abnormal pressure rise in the valve cavity.
4. Low torque design. The specially designed valve stem allows for easy opening and closing with just a small handwheel.
5. Wedge-shaped sealing structure. The valve seals by the mechanical force provided by the valve stem pressing the ball wedge against the valve seat. This ensures reliable sealing performance under various operating conditions, unaffected by pipeline pressure differences.
6. Self-cleaning structure of the sealing surface. When the ball tilts away from the valve seat, the fluid in the pipeline flows evenly along the ball’s sealing surface in a 360° arc. This not only eliminates the localized scouring of the valve seat by high-speed fluid but also washes away accumulated substances on the sealing surface, achieving a self-cleaning effect.
